Medical Radiology & Imaging Technology

The Medical Radiology & Imaging Technology (MRIT) program at CT University prepares students for a career in medical imaging sciences. The curriculum covers X-rays, CT, MRI, Ultrasonography, and Nuclear Medicine, integrating anatomy, physiology, pathology, radiological physics, and radiation protection. Students gain hands-on experience through state-of-the-art labs and clinical internships in reputed hospitals, ensuring proficiency in image processing, quality assurance, and patient care. This dynamic field blends technical expertise with medical science, making it a crucial and rewarding profession in modern healthcare, where skilled radiology professionals play a vital role in accurate diagnosis and patient management.
